Indonesia’s Lion Air finds cracks in two 737 NGs with fewer flights than FAA safety directive

Lion Air has found structural cracks in two Boeing Co 737 NG planes with fewer flights than a U.S. Federal Aviation Administration (FAA) threshold for checks, Indonesia’s aviation safety regulator said on Friday.
